Four Seasons Astir Palace Hotel Athens

After an extensive renovation, the historic Astir Palace reopened this year as the first Four Seasons Hotels and Resorts property in Greece.
Although it sits on the Athenian Riviera, this idyllic seaside retreat is just half an hour from the historic city centre, so guests can easily explore ancient Athens during their stay.
Set across 75 acres of pine forest, Astir Palace boasts three private beaches, eight restaurants, lounges and bars, exclusive boutiques and a spa inspired by the Hippocratic philosophy of holistic wellbeing.
The hotel comprises two separate buildings, Nafsika and Arion, along with several private bungalows.
At Nafsika, the suites come with a private pool and offer breathtaking sea views, while the modernist Arion building is styled in retro chic.

Sani Asterias Sani Resort, Halkidiki, Greece

Surrounded by pine forest and sandy beaches, Sani Resort spreads across a lavish 1,000-acre estate on the Kassandra peninsula.
The exclusive Sani Asterias is one of the resort's five luxury hotels.
It features 57 elegant suites with a private terrace and direct access to the exclusive Sani Asterias beach, with stunning views over the Aegean Sea.
There's also a three-bedroom deluxe suite that comes with a private pool, three bathrooms and express in-room check-in and check-out.
Among the boutique hotel's other highlights are a spa offering exclusive aromatherapy treatments by Anne Sémonin and the Water restaurant, where three-Michelin-star chef Mauro Colagreco has created a remarkable menu rooted mainly in Mediterranean and French cuisine.

The Romanos at Costa Navarino, Messinia

Set in Messinia in the southwest of the Peloponnese, Costa Navarino is the embodiment of exclusive coastal living.
Nestled among olive groves, The Romanos, a Luxury Collection Resort, is one of the two luxury resorts at this destination.
This award-winning hotel has 321 rooms, suites and villas with private infinity pools and majestic views over the Ionian Sea.
The 660-square-metre Royal Villa Koroni is the most lavish of them all, offering exclusive amenities such as a private gym and spa area.
Fine-dining restaurants, a first-class spa and VIP helicopter service are among the resort's luxury offerings, alongside activities like cooking master classes and stargazing evenings.

Amanzoe, Peloponnese

Perched on a hilltop and surrounded by olive groves, Amanzoe offers a sweeping panorama of the eastern Peloponnese coast and the Argo-Saronic Gulf.
This luxury resort lies in Porto Heli, close to archaeological sites such as the ancient city of Halieis and the beautiful island of Spetses.
Its freestanding luxury pavilions come with terraces and private pools, while the resort's one- to nine-bedroom villas offer the services of a personal chef and host.
The Amanzoe Beach Club, set just below the resort in a sheltered bay, includes a private beach, four pools, casual dining, a two-treatment-room spa and overnight cabanas where guests can wake to the sound of the sea.

Lichnos Beach Hotel and Suites, Parga

Set in the tranquil bay of Lichnos along the shimmering waters of the Ionian Sea, Lichnos Beach Hotel and Suites offers an outdoor infinity pool, two restaurants and a beach bar.
The surrounding green hills create the perfect setting for this secluded five-star luxury beach resort in Parga, Epirus.
It features a range of luxury bungalows and rooms, including a beachfront executive suite with sea views, a private balcony and an outdoor jacuzzi, the ideal spot to watch the sunset.
At 78 square metres, the Suite Prince Faisal is the most luxurious of all, with two huge balconies, two bedrooms, a dining area and a living room.

Daphnila Bay Dassia, Corfu

Set on a green hillside overlooking Dassia Bay in Corfu, Daphnila Bay Dassia effortlessly blends its seaside location with luxurious design.
Facing the Ionian Sea, its many draws include a rejuvenating spa, excellent cuisine, a Blue Flag beach and beautiful gardens filled with olive and pine trees.
Guests can dive into the freshwater pool, unwind on the beach or join in a host of entertainment options, including live music and folk dance shows.
Corfu's wonderful Old Town,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, is just a 20-minute drive from the hotel.

Casa Cook Kos

Set on Kos, the birthplace of Hippocrates, this stylish adults-only resort is a perfect base for exploring the Dodecanese island.
Inspired by the traditional architecture of the Greek islands, the resort's 100 rooms range from double rooms to villas with a private garden and pool.
The hotel's contemporary restaurant follows a farm-to-table approach, with a menu created by Corfiot Italian restaurateur Ettore Botrini together with chef Theodora Lampropoulou.

Abaton Island Resort and Spa, Crete

Heraklion, the lively capital of Crete, is just 30 kilometres from this stylish resort.
Abaton Island Resort and Spa has 152 rooms, suites and villas. Standouts include the two-storey Dream Villa and the Royal Villa, both with captivating views over the Cretan Sea, private heated pools, spacious outdoor areas and butler service.
The resort has five restaurants serving everything from sushi and signature steaks to local Greek cuisine and international dishes.
There's also a world-class Elemis spa with five treatment rooms and a fitness centre.

Grecotel Mykonos Blu

Perfectly positioned on the sandy Psarou beach, Mykonos Blu is made up of beautiful island bungalows and private villas with captivating views over the Aegean Sea.
The resort, set very close to the buzzing town of Mykonos, is reachable by ferry or plane.
Blue and white are the dominant colours throughout, harmonising with the distinctive architecture of the cosmopolitan Cycladic island and its natural surroundings.
A magnificent seawater infinity pool is one of the 20 pools here.
Mykonos Blu also offers activities such as yoga classes, and guests can use private water taxis for trips to neighbouring islands.

Domes Noruz Chania

This adults-only boutique resort is perfect for anyone wanting to explore the colourful town of Chania or take a dip at the famous Falasarna beach.
Domes Noruz Chania has 83 uniquely designed rooms and suites with a pool, an outdoor jacuzzi or a private pool.
The Ultimate Haven Suite, set right by the beach, is one of the most impressive, with two bathrooms featuring walk-in showers and three LED televisions.
Free daily yoga and mobility classes are held outdoors overlooking the Aegean Sea.
At the rooftop Raw bar, talented mixologists craft bespoke cocktails while guests take in the views.
